Adds a group-by-project toggle to the Sessions header. When ON, the flat session list becomes a grouped list — one section per project, preview-capped at 6 agents per project with "Show N more" / "Show less" controls per group. When OFF, the flat list stays as before. Architecture preserves the Phase 7b perf model: - Controller (useSidebarSessionsController) owns groupByProject and expandedProjects state. Expansion resets on grouping-off, host change, and filter change. Group-by persists across hosts as a UI preference. - A new useOrderedAgentProjectShape selector reactively subscribes to per-agent cwd via useStoreWithEqualityFn(..., shallow). When project assignments don't change, the array reference stays stable; when an agent's project changes, the parent re-derives groups. Shape objects are reused across renders when project fields are unchanged. - deriveGroupedSidebarSessions takes the resolved shape directly (no callback indirection) and returns ordered groups with visible/hidden ids based on per-project expansion state. - Header and Footer components are React.memo'd with primitive props only, so they don't re-render on irrelevant agent updates. Per-row status indicators continue to subscribe via the shared tab descriptor path, isolated from parent renders. - Project ordering: first-occurrence in the createdAt-desc id list, matching the user's mental model of "most-recent project first" and avoiding a per-render activity-timestamp computation. Visual primitive shared between the workspace tree project row and the new Sessions group header (packages/app/src/components/sidebar/ sidebar-project-row-visual.tsx) — no two systems for project visuals. The workspace tree wraps it with its own chevron/status; the Sessions header uses it bare. Tests added: state-machine cases on the controller, pure-helper coverage on grouping derivation, render-boundary stability for grouped data references across irrelevant updates and reactivity on project changes, and a footer click test.

Dictation debugging
Set EXPO_PUBLIC_ENABLE_AUDIO_DEBUG=1 before running npx expo start to render the in-app audio debug card. Pair it with the server-side STT_DEBUG_AUDIO_DIR flag so every dictation includes a copyable path to the saved raw audio file.
